Ariel Lugo, MS
Ariel provides a compassionate, authentic, and supportive space for clients to explore life’s challenges and personal growth. Her therapeutic approach is integrative, drawing from person-centered principles while incorporating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T), and play therapy techniques when appropriate. Ariel believes that healing is not a one-size-fits-all process and strives to meet each client where they are, honoring their unique experiences, goals, and strengths. Clients often appreciate Ariel’s honesty, empathy, and ability to navigate difficult conversations with warmth and understanding. She values building meaningful therapeutic relationships that foster connection, self-discovery, and empowerment throughout the counseling process.
EDUCATION & expertise
Ariel’s professional journey began in the arts, where she developed a deep appreciation for human connection, empathy, and storytelling. After earning her degree in Theatre, she pursued her passion for understanding human development by obtaining an undergraduate degree in Developmental Psychology, followed by a Master’s degree in Clinical Mental Health Counseling. Ariel works with children, adolescents, young adults, women, LGBTQ+ individuals, and neurodivergent populations. Her primary areas of focus include anxiety, depression, and life transitions, with a growing specialty interest in autism spectrum disorder, ADHD, and trauma. As both a clinician and a member of the neurodivergent community, Ariel brings a unique combination of professional training and personal insight to her work, helping clients feel seen, understood, and supported in their healing journeys.
